WebJan 19, 2024 · Storytelling is one of the most important tools of any educator or parent of a child with ASD. It helps autistic children master language skills, increase attention spans, and build social interactions. Children can get involved by repeating certain phrases or by acting out a part of the story. Some children with autism are very good at communicating their needs and understanding others’ communication, while others may need additional support in this area. WebThe Education (Additional Support for Learning) (Scotland) Act 2004 boosted the rights of parents of children with additional support needs (ASN) by improving access to information, instituting a Code of Practice and establishing new redress mechanisms such as the ASN Tribunal and independent mediation. More than a decade later, Scottish legislation …
